Green Game TimeSwapper is a fast-paced action puzzler about a steampunk bird flying through gauntlets of spikes, pistons, and other dangers, out now for iOS, PS Vita, and Steam.

While its oddly named precursor Red Game Without a Great Name had you teleporting through hazards, Green Game TimeSwapper lets you control the flow of time. By swiping left or right, you can manipulate time and in turn affect the direction of steam jets, the orientation of windmills, the location of barriers, and so on.

Your mechanical fowl flies onward on its own, so precise use of steam jets to push the bird around dangers is key to reaching the end in one piece. Levels feature different paths to navigate and include hard-to-reach gears to collect, testing your time-controlling skills.

Green Game TimeSwapper is available now on £2.29 / $2.99 on the App Store, and £3.99 / $4.99 on Steam and PS Vita.
